Willie James Blair, Jr.

Willie James Blair, Jr., age 75, passed away Saturday, July 21, 2018. He was born May 12, 1943 in Houston, Texas to parents W.J. and Grace Blair who preceded him in death along with his wife, Mertiss Idell Blair.

Mr. Blair worked for Southern Pacific Railroad and Houston Lighting and Power for many years.

Survivors include his sister, Virginia Pylant and husband Kenny; brothers, Ralph Blair and wife Sandra, Richard Blair and wife Lynn; numerous grandchildren, nieces and nephews.

Visitation will be held from 11:00 a.m. – 12:00 noon, Wednesday, August 1, 2018 at Pace Stancil Chapel, Cleveland, Texas. Services will follow starting at 12:00 noon, Wednesday, August 1, 2018 at Pace Stancil Chapel, Cleveland, Texas. Interment will follow at Ryan Cemetery, Cleveland, Texas.
